Hydrophilic PES Membranes: Enhancing Filtration Performance
PES membranes, traditionally regarded for their outstanding mechanical durability and solvent resistance, often exhibit limited wetting characteristics in aqueous environments. Despite modifying these membranes to render water-attracting significantly improves their filtration performance. Exterior treatment techniques, such as grafting hydrophilic chains like polyethylene oxide or adding active groups, result to a significant reduction in filter fouling and increased flow rate. This consequently translates to more productive and cost-effective filtration applications across various industries.}

Choosing the Right Hydrophilic PES Membrane for Your Process
Selecting the correct hydrophilic polyethersulfone sheet for the particular system requires detailed evaluation concerning several aspects. Initial pore size should match your mixture's particle distribution for optimal clarification. Moreover, consider the film's hydrophilic properties – greater wetting tendencies usually produce enhanced efficiency during watery liquids, minimizing clogging & maintaining reliable permeability. In conclusion, ensure to consult supplier's data and run test experiments should possible.
Improving Filtration with Hydrophilic PES Membranes
Superior separation efficiency can be attained using moisture-attracting Polyethersulfone (PES) membranes . Traditional PES substances often exhibit water-repelling properties , restricting their application in watery processes . Yet, surface modification to impart moisture-attraction dramatically improves saturation and reduces clogging , causing in improved flow rate and extended filter duration. This makes them ideal for a diverse selection of fields such as biological processing and water treatment .
